Sargos Sector lies on the very edge of the galaxy. For centuries Sargos Sector was rendered uninhabitable and isolated by volatile Warp Storms.Until now, deep within the sector the very fabric of reality is unraveling and only the ancient Sentinel Devices hold the Warp at bay.
But the Sentinel Devices have been weakened by the ravages of time and meddling of humanity-and now, the battle for these lost worlds is at hand. For the conflict, the great races of the galaxy atteck on the Sargos Sector seeking to preserve reality-or to tear it asunder.

Warhammer 40,000 (informally known as Warhammer 40K or simply 40K) is a tabletop miniature wargame produced by Games Workshop, set in a science fantasy universe. Warhammer 40,000 was created by Rick Priestley in 1987 as the futuristic companion to Warhammer Fantasy Battle, sharing many game mechanics. Expansions for Warhammer 40,000 are released from time to time which give rules for urban, planetary siege and large-scale combat, respectively. The game is currently in its fifth edition, which was published in 2008.
